The Importance Of DNA Testing For Prenatal Paternity Verification

Prenatal paternity testing is a process in which the paternity of an unborn child is determined before the baby is born This procedure can be done through a variety of methods, with one of the most accurate being a DNA test DNA testing for prenatal paternity has become increasingly popular in recent years due to its high level of accuracy and reliability.

One of the main reasons why individuals opt for prenatal DNA testing is to establish paternity before the child is born This can be particularly important in situations where there may be uncertainty surrounding the identity of the biological father By determining paternity before the birth of the child, it can help to alleviate any doubts or concerns that may arise later on.

Another important reason why prenatal paternity testing is conducted is to prepare for the legal responsibilities that come with fatherhood Establishing paternity early on can help both parents to plan for the future and make decisions regarding custody, child support, and other parental responsibilities It can also help to ensure that the child has access to important medical information and benefits from both sides of their genetic heritage.

When it comes to DNA testing for prenatal paternity, there are two main methods that are typically used: amniocentesis and chorionic villus sampling (CVS) Both of these procedures involve collecting a sample of the baby’s DNA, which can then be analyzed to determine the paternity of the child.

Amniocentesis is typically performed between the 14th and 20th week of pregnancy During this procedure, a long, thin needle is inserted through the abdomen and into the uterus to collect a small amount of amniotic fluid This fluid contains cells that have been shed by the baby, which can then be used for DNA analysis.

Chorionic villus sampling, on the other hand, is usually performed between the 10th and 13th week of pregnancy This procedure involves collecting a sample of cells from the placenta, which also contain the baby’s DNA dna test for prenatal paternity. The sample can be obtained either through the abdomen or through the cervix, depending on the preferences of the healthcare provider.

Both of these procedures are considered safe and have a low risk of complications However, as with any medical procedure, there are potential risks involved, such as infection or injury to the fetus It is important for expectant mothers to discuss the benefits and risks of prenatal paternity testing with their healthcare provider before making a decision.
